Uninstalling the MCC 3100 application
using the Desktop Manager
Note: Before you remove the MCC 3100 application, ensure that the
BlackBerry Desktop Manager is installed and that the USB cable is
connected to both your computer and handheld.
1. Exit the MCC 3100 application if it is running.
See
"Starting and exiting the MCC 3100 application" on page
2. Launch the BlackBerry Desktop Manager by selecting Start >
Programs > BlackBerry > Desktop Manager.
3. Click Application Loader.
The Application Loader Wizard appears.
4. Click Next.
If the Desktop Manager detects the communication port, the Device
Application Selection dialog box appears and skip to step 6.
Otherwise, the Communication Port Selection dialog box appears.
5. Select a communication port, and click Next.
The Device Application Selection dialog box appears.
